**Onboarding: ParcelPulse webhook recovery**

New folks joining the Harrowgate delivery team: the ParcelPulse webhook relays tracking events from the courier gateway into our status board. If the relay account is ever deactivated, restoration follows the two-person rule — one engineer initiates from the Ombra console, another approves. During approval, the console prompts for the relay account's recovery passphrase, which is recorded immediately below this paragraph.

strongbox words: istath-queneth-ralwyn

Hey, welcome aboard! As release manager for Dovetail Ledger, you'll own the locale bundles, including date formats. Quick gotcha: the Marrowby pipeline regenerates date patterns per region on every release cut, and if the localization vault is locked, the whole cut stalls. You'll know because the logs say "bundle sealed." Don't panic — just open the vault unlock screen from the release dashboard and re-seed it. It'll ask for the recovery passphrase, noted here:

unlock words, hahip-baduf: holwyn-istath-julvan

# Capacity Note: Relevance Tuning on Larkfield Search

Welcome aboard! Quick heads-up before you touch the Larkfield ranking pipeline: relevance experiments re-score the full candidate set, so every tweak has a real capacity cost. We budget rescoring headroom per node, and the boost weights below interact with cache hit rates more than you'd expect. Keep experiments behind the flag service and watch p95 latency on the dashboards. The constants we currently run in production are these.

tuning constants:
QUOTAS = {
    "druwyn": 5,
    "holix": 5,
    "zorath": 5,
    "holwyn": 10,
}

## Artifact Signing for Castwren Feed Validator

Welcome aboard. Every validator release is built by the Harborline pipeline and signed before distribution; unsigned builds are rejected by the update channel, so never sideload artifacts manually. After your build passes the feed-conformance suite, the pipeline signs the archive automatically. To verify a release locally, check its signature against the project signing key provided just below.

rollout seal: bky9_PeXH1fTLY